Announcement

Collapse
No announcement yet.

Bitmap laden

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Bitmap laden

    Hallo Leute,

    ich möchte ein Bitmap laden, um des dann z.B. mittels eines HBITMAP zu verwenden. Leider habe ich nur Infos gefunden, wie man Bitmaps aus einer Ressourcen-Datei lädt. Das solls derade nicht sein. Letztendlich soll der Nutzer über den Standarddialog Datei öffnen eine Datei auswählen können.

    Danke Thomas

  • #2
    Hallo Thomas,
    schaum mal <a href="http://msdn.microsoft.com/library/default.asp?url=/library/en-us/winui/winui/windowsuserinterface/resources/introductiontoresources/resourcereference/resourcefunctions/loadimage.asp">
    LoadImage</a> <br><br>
    (HBITMAP)LoadImage(0, 'c:\grafik.bmp', IMAGE_BITMAP, 0, 0, LR_LOADFROMFILE

    Comment


    • #3
      Danke,

      warum könnte folgender Code nicht funktionieren:

      HANDLE handle = LoadImage( 0,
      TEXT( "Beispiel.bmp" ),
      IMAGE_BITMAP,
      0, 0,
      LR_LOADFROMFILE ) ;
      SendDlgItemMessage( hDlg,
      IDC_Objekt_Bild1,
      STM_SETIMAGE,
      IMAGE_BITMAP,
      (LPARAM)handle ) ;

      IDC_Objekt_Bild1 ist ein static control im Dialog hDlg. Leider wird nichts angezeigt.:-(

      Weiß jemand Rat?

      Thoma

      Comment

      Working...
      X